Subject: mm/huge_memory: fix pgtable withdrawal for huge zero PMDs
Date: Sun, 13 Sep 2026 13:19:42 +0800
has_deposited_pgtable() uses !vma_is_dax() to decide whether a huge zero
PMD has a deposited PTE page table. That also accepts raw PFN mappings of
huge_zero_pfn, although vmf_insert_pfn_pmd() does not deposit a page table
on x86.
Zapping such a mapping would call pgtable_trans_huge_withdraw() without a
corresponding deposit. With pmd_huge_pte(mm, pmd) == NULL, that causes a
NULL pointer dereference.
Use vma_is_anonymous() for the huge zero PMD check. This matches how PTE
page tables are allocated, deposited and moved.
- For anonymous page faults that install a huge zero PMD,
do_huge_pmd_anonymous_page() allocates a PTE page table and
set_huge_zero_folio() deposits it before installing the PMD.
- On fork, copy_huge_pmd() allocates and deposits a PTE page table when
copying a huge zero PMD into an anonymous VMA.
- Raw PFN mappings use vmf_insert_pfn_pmd(), and DAX file holes use
vmf_insert_folio_pmd() to map the huge zero folio. Both use insert_pmd(),
which deposits a PTE page table only when arch_needs_pgtable_deposit()
requires it.
- Moving an anonymous huge PMD preserves its deposited PTE page table.
move_huge_pmd() transfers the deposit when necessary. For UFFD MOVE,
both VMAs must be anonymous, and move_pages_huge_pmd() transfers the
deposit as well.
Keep arch_needs_pgtable_deposit() first so architectures that require a
deposited PTE page table still return true regardless of the VMA type.
Commit d80a9cb1a64a ("mm/huge_memory: add and use
normal_or_softleaf_folio_pmd()") removed the vma_is_special_huge() check
in zap_huge_pmd(). That check skipped the huge zero PMD deposit test for
non-DAX VM_PFNMAP and VM_MIXEDMAP mappings. Removing it exposed these
mappings to the incorrect !vma_is_dax() test.
